A simple change to my morning routine made a huge difference in my work
For years, I'd start my day by checking email and Slack the second I woke up, which meant I was already stressed before I even had coffee. About three months ago, I read a blog post that suggested waiting 90 minutes before opening any work apps. I was skeptical, but I tried it. Now, I spend that first hour just having breakfast, maybe reading a book, and planning my top three tasks for the day on a notepad. I'm way less frazzled by 10 AM and actually get more done because I start focused. Has anyone else tried something like this and found a specific time that works for them?
